2
0
mirror of https://github.com/acepanel/templates.git synced 2026-02-07 08:14:09 +08:00
Files
templates/pg4admin/docker-compose.yml
renovate[bot] 3dc5bfef6c chore(deps): update docker images (minor/patch/digest) (#31)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2026-02-05 18:37:14 +00:00

24 lines
593 B
YAML

services:
pgadmin4:
image: dpage/pgadmin4:9.12
restart: unless-stopped
user: "0:0"
environment:
PGADMIN_DEFAULT_EMAIL: ${PGADMIN_DEFAULT_EMAIL}
PGADMIN_DEFAULT_PASSWORD: ${PGADMIN_DEFAULT_PASSWORD}
UMASK: 022
ports:
- ${PGADMIN_PORT}:80
volumes:
- ./data:/var/lib/pgadmin
healthcheck:
test: [ "CMD-SHELL", "wget -qO- http://localhost:80/misc/ping || exit 1" ]
interval: 30s
timeout: 10s
retries: 3
start_period: 30s
networks:
- acepanel-network
networks:
acepanel-network:
external: true